whistling(2) (iou)
whistling verbal noun. OE.
[from WHISTLE verb + -ING1.]
The action of WHISTLE verb; an instance of this.
Comb.: whistling-shop arch. slang a room in a prison where spirits were secretly sold without a licence (a whistle being given to escape detection).
ganglion submandibulare (medicine)
ganglion submandibulare -->
submandibular ganglion
A small parasympathetic ganglion suspended from the lingual nerve; its postganglionic branches go to the submandibular and sublingual glands; its preganglionic fibres come from the superior salvatory nucleus by way of the chorda tympani.
Synonym: ganglion submandibulare, submaxillary ganglion.
